Abstract

The utility model relates to a hot rolling screw steel rod straightening and cutting machine, in particular to a straightening mechanism for hot rolling screw steel rod straightening and cutting machine. The utility model is characterized in that five straightening blocks(6) are arranged inside a rotary cylinder(1) of a straightening mechanism. Inside a guide groove, distance between the straightening block(6) and an axial line of the rotary cylinder(1) is adjusted by an adjusting screw(2). A bearing(4)arranged at two ends of a wheel frame(5) is arranged on the straightening block(6), while a straightening roller(7) is arranged on the wheel frame(5). As the utility model adopts the designing, no scratch marks are existed on a vertical rib and horizontal rib of the hot rolling screw steel rod after the straightening, and mechanical properties of the steel rod is same as that before the straightening. .

The straightening mechanism of hot-rolled screw thread reinforcing bar aligning cutting-off device
The utility model relates to a kind of hot-rolled screw thread reinforcing bar aligning cutting-off device, particularly relates to a kind of straightening mechanism of hot-rolled screw thread reinforcing bar aligning cutting-off device.
Be used for straightening hot-rolled screw thread reinforcing bar at present, most of employing levels---vertical multiple roll straightening scheme and drum-type curve roller straightening scheme, because being used for the straightener roll of straightening does circumferential rolling friction on the surface of reinforcing bar, thereby make steel longitudinal rib, cross rib surface after the straightening be subjected to the different damage of degree, by the flow harden phenomenon, change the mechanical property of reinforcing bar, can not satisfy instructions for use.
The purpose of this utility model is to provide a kind of straightening mechanism of hot-rolled screw thread reinforcing bar, and reinforcing bar is after this mechanism's straightening, and its vertical rib, cross rib surface do not have cut, and the mechanical property of reinforcing bar does not have change with the last sample of straightening, has satisfied the instructions for use of hot-rolled screw thread reinforcing bar.
The straightening mechanism of this hot-rolled screw thread reinforcing bar aligning cutting-off device is made up of rotating cylinder 1, adjustment screw 2, pressing plate 3, rolling bearing 4, wheel carrier 5, straightening piece 6, straightener roll 7, rolling bearing 8 and bearing cap 9 etc., it is characterized in that: straightening piece 6 is installed in the guide-track groove of rotating cylinder 1, can move up and down the distance of straightening piece 6 and rotating cylinder 1 axis by adjustment screw 2, wheel carrier 5 two ends are equipped with rolling bearing 4 and are installed in the straightening piece 6, and straightener roll 7 is installed on the wheel carrier 5; Straightening piece 6 rotates with rotating cylinder 1, can relatively rotate between wheel carrier 5 and the straightening piece 6; Straightener roll 7 is installed in the wheel carrier 5 by rolling bearing 8, and is rotatable at the axial direction straightener roll 7 of rotating cylinder 1, and do not rotate in circumferential direction, in 5 one-tenth inactive states of wheel carrier; Straightener roll 7 has identical grooved, wherein: b=a+0.1mm, R=1/2d, h=0,47-0.55R; Centre distance straightener roll (7) external diameter of grooved R size is h, and both sides R face contacts with the reinforcing bar inner diameter d, does not contact with cross rib, and the vertical rib two sides of reinforcing bar are in grooved b.

Accompanying drawing 1 is the disclosed embodiment of the utility model (seeing Fig. 1, Fig. 2, Fig. 3), 5 the straightening pieces 6 of in rotating cylinder 1 guide-track groove, packing into, pressing plate 3 is fixing with rotating cylinder 1, pressing plate 3 is provided with screwed hole, but adjustment screw 2 is by the distance of screwed hole up-down adjustment straightening piece 6 with rotating cylinder 1 axis, it is combined with straightening piece 6 that bearing 4 is equipped with at wheel carrier 5 two ends, and it is fixing with wheel carrier 5 usefulness bearing caps 9 that bearing 8 is equipped with at the straightener roll two ends.
Need to be penetrated respectively in the grooved of forming by 5 pairs of straightener rolls 6 by vertical rib direction by the hot-rolled screw thread reinforcing bar of straightening, head, tail, middle straightening piece 6 are regulated centering with adjustment screw 2 respectively, all the other straightening piece 6 directions can equidirectional or rightabout and rotating cylinder 1 journal offset certain distance, regulate with adjustment screw 2, each pushes down the reinforcing bar inner diameter d with suitable drafts, and reinforcing bar is advanced by the carry-over pinch rolls traction of aligning cutting-off device.Rotating cylinder 1 is high speed rotary under the effect of motor power, and the reinforcing bar original curved has been done the repeatedly rightabout bending in a plurality of straightening unit, makes reinforcing bar obtain straightening.
In rotating cylinder 1 high speed rotary process, 1 one-tenth inactive state of straightening piece 6 relative rotating cylinders, along with rotating cylinder 1 revolution, because the effect of rolling bearing 4,6 existence of 5 pairs of straightening pieces of wheel carrier relatively rotate, with rotating cylinder 1 rotation.Straightener roll 7 is contained in the wheel carrier 5, because the effect of rolling bearing 8, at the axis direction of rotating cylinder 1, straightener roll 7 exists with wheel carrier 5 and relatively rotates, and is that the cross rib direction becomes relative static conditions with the circumferential direction of reinforcing bar, does not rotate.Straightener roll 7 is at the axial direction of reinforcing bar, because grooved R center roll surface h distance, the R two sides only contact a part with the reinforcing bar inner diameter d, do not contact with cross rib, vertical rib two sides are stuck among the grooved b, R, h, b, a size are determined by the size shown in the bar gauge, thereby straightener roll 7 is only done rolling friction with the reinforcing bar inner diameter d in circumferential direction, do not contact with steel longitudinal rib, cross rib, thereby guaranteed its vertical rib cross rib no marking of hot-rolled screw thread reinforcing bar after this straightening mechanism straightening effectively, the mechanical property of reinforcing bar does not have change.
